The OpenNET Project / Index page

[ новости /+++ | форум | wiki | теги | ]

Релиз СУБД Firebird 2.5.1

07.10.2011 13:08

Спустя год после выхода СУБД Firebird 2.5 представлен корректирующий релиз Firebird 2.5.1. Кроме исправления ошибок, в новой версии представлено несколько улучшений:

  • Заметно увеличена производительность восстановления БД (gbak restore) на стадии добавления данных;
  • Добавлена поддержка записи в глобальные временные таблицы для баз, находящихся в режиме только для чтения. Увеличена производительность глобальных временных таблиц и эффективность работы сборщика мусора;
  • В PSQL добавлена поддержка контекстной переменной SQLSTATE, которая может использоваться в блоках WHEN наряду с переменными GDSCODE и SQLCODE для диагностики ошибок;
  • В API добавлены функции преобразования между BLOB и другими типами данных;
  • В Services API добавлена поддержка восстановления только мета-данных (режим metadata-only);
  • Незанятые байты переменной VARCHAR в буфере сообщения теперь обязательно обнуляются;
  • Переменная MON$STATEMENT_ID теперь остаётся неизменной для различных снимков состояния при мониторинге;
  • Для клиентских соединений теперь активируется опция SO_KEEPALIVE;
  • Устранена проблема, приводившая к невозможности запуска СУБД в режимах Superserver и Superclassic на платформе Mac OS X 10.7;
  • Проведена оптимизация менеджера сохранения временных данных, которые теперь оперирует цепочками меньшего размера и более эффективно расходует дисковое пространство;
  • В Lock Manager добавлена возможность отмены ожидания завершения транзакции, длительное время находящейся в состоянии WAIT из-за ожидание завершения другой транзакции, которая в свою очередь не может быть завершена. Отмена может быть совершена через запрос "DELETE FROM MON$xxx" или вызов "fb_cancel_operation";
  • Оптимизатор запросов теперь учитывает реальный размер записей с учётом степени сжатия;
  • Обеспечено портирование Linux-сборки для платформ HPPA и Alpha.


  1. Главная ссылка к новости (http://www.firebirdsql.org/en/...)
  2. OpenNews: Релиз СУБД Firebird 2.5
  3. OpenNews: Вышел релиз СУБД Firebird 2.1.3
  4. OpenNews: Вышел релиз СУБД Firebird 2.1.2
  5. OpenNews: Вышел релиз СУБД Firebird 2.0.5
Лицензия: CC-BY
Тип: Программы
Ключевые слова: firebird, database
При перепечатке указание ссылки на opennet.ru обязательно
Обсуждение (59) Ajax/Линейный | Раскрыть все сообщения | RSS
 
  • 1.1, Аноним (-), 13:27, 07/10/2011 [ответить] [показать ветку] [···]    [к модератору]
  • +/
    Просто из интереса: ей сейчас много кто пользуется?
     
     
  • 2.2, Suberjin (ok), 13:43, 07/10/2011 [^] [ответить]    [к модератору]
  • +1 +/
    таки да.
    У нас в стране программа отчетности в пенсионный фонд использует Firebird + клиент-Банку нужен Firebird.
     
     
  • 3.4, whip (?), 13:49, 07/10/2011 [^] [ответить]    [к модератору]
  • +/
    еще УРМ Криста, который стоит во всех бюджетных учреждениях
     
     
  • 4.52, anthonio (ok), 05:47, 10/10/2011 [^] [ответить]    [к модератору]
  • +/
    не во всех. её выдавливает кое-где АЦК.
     
  • 2.3, 3plet (?), 13:46, 07/10/2011 [^] [ответить]    [к модератору]
  • –1 +/
    Знаю несколько "клиент-банков"
     
     
  • 3.7, Andrey Mitrofanov (?), 14:03, 07/10/2011 [^] [ответить]    [к модератору]  
  • +6 +/
    Как?! А куда делись clipper и ms-dos? Ж)
     
     
  • 4.8, жабабыдлокодер (ok), 14:19, 07/10/2011 [^] [ответить]    [к модератору]  
  • +1 +/
    Кое-где еще живы. Если система работает, и результаты работы устраивают, нахрена ее трогать?
     
     
  • 5.22, Xasd (ok), 19:21, 07/10/2011 [^] [ответить]     [к модератору]  
  • +1 +/
    ответ на ваш вопрос -- очевидин - трогать систему нужно в целях предупрежд... весь текст скрыт [показать]
     
     
  • 6.44, Ytch (?), 08:36, 09/10/2011 [^] [ответить]    [к модератору]  
  • +/
    2а. Если вдруг придётся вводить изменения, то это некому будет сделать (чем более древние системы/технологии, тем меньше людей умеющих и желающих в этом копаться).
     
  • 4.23, Аноним (-), 19:33, 07/10/2011 [^] [ответить]    [к модератору]  
  • +1 +/
    > Как?! А куда делись clipper и ms-dos? Ж)

    DOS был низведен до касс :)

     
  • 2.5, animechaos (ok), 13:58, 07/10/2011 [^] [ответить]    [к модератору]  
  • +/
    Не безызвестный "Бизнес Пак", например.
     
  • 2.6, _linux_ (?), 13:59, 07/10/2011 [^] [ответить]    [к модератору]  
  • +/
    У нас на работе эта СУБД используется на сервере для POS-систем. Наверно далекое наследство Delphi.
     
     
  • 3.10, Анонимизатор (?), 14:25, 07/10/2011 [^] [ответить]    [к модератору]  
  • +/
    Таксистские всякие CRM запилены под эту СУБД.
     
  • 2.21, matt (??), 19:11, 07/10/2011 [^] [ответить]    [к модератору]  
  • +/
    FireBird 1.5 -- СБСОФТ Планово-финансовая отчётность, практически весь софт "Почты России" (WinPost, Доставочный участок, Регистратор документов, подписки и лотерии)
     
     
  • 3.24, Аноним (-), 19:40, 07/10/2011 [^] [ответить]     [к модератору]  
  • +1 +/
    Ах, так вот почему почта россии так жопно работает и тормозит ... весь текст скрыт [показать]
     
     
  • 4.37, Square (ok), 11:18, 08/10/2011 [^] [ответить]     [к модератору]  
  • +/
    У почты России чтото в ИТ департаменте тормозит они регулярно шарахаются из с... весь текст скрыт [показать]
     
  • 2.40, nalcheg (ok), 20:19, 08/10/2011 [^] [ответить]    [к модератору]  
  • +/
    у приставов делфинячья прога на фаерберде работает
     
  • 1.9, Аноним (-), 14:23, 07/10/2011 [ответить] [показать ветку] [···]     [к модератору]  
  • +2 +/
    Эта СУБД уровня PostgreSQL, в каких то моментах может и чем-то уступает, а где-т... весь текст скрыт [показать]
     
     
  • 2.11, VoDA (ok), 14:26, 07/10/2011 [^] [ответить]     [к модератору]  
  • –1 +/
    К сожалению postgres на обладает фичей невосстановимый бэкап, так что постгря од... весь текст скрыт [показать]
     
     
  • 3.13, Аноним (-), 15:08, 07/10/2011 [^] [ответить]    [к модератору]  
  • +/
    Это как?
     
     
  • 4.19, pro100master (ok), 17:45, 07/10/2011 [^] [ответить]    [к модератору]  
  • +/
    это ООО Кривые Руки, так
     
  • 4.27, Гектор Зажигайло (?), 21:22, 07/10/2011 [^] [ответить]     [к модератору]  
  • +/
    Это он когда-то давно прочитал про древний баг В Firebird есть такая фишка как ... весь текст скрыт [показать]
     
     
  • 5.29, Аноним (-), 22:00, 07/10/2011 [^] [ответить]    [к модератору]  
  • +/
    Зажигайло, на этот счет в нормальных СУБД есть директива FORCE - "создать объект даже, если депендентный объект не существует" :).

    CREATE OR REPLACE VIEW FORCE AS SELECT...

     
     
  • 6.31, Гектор Зажигайло (?), 22:38, 07/10/2011 [^] [ответить]     [к модератору]  
  • +/
    Я тоже люблю отвечать, нифига не поняв смысла высказываний собеседника пример ... весь текст скрыт [показать]
     
     
  • 7.33, Avator (ok), 23:28, 07/10/2011 [^] [ответить]    [к модератору]  
  • +/
    хм... прикольно.
    А если процедура уже создана, а после этого столбец дропнули, что будет?
     
     
  • 8.34, Anonymouse (?), 01:44, 08/10/2011 [^] [ответить]    [к модератору]  
  • +/
    (|) вестимо. Впрочем она будет уже после факта использования этого софтвыра....

     
  • 8.38, Xtron (?), 14:58, 08/10/2011 [^] [ответить]    [к модератору]  
  • +/
    Дропнуть не сможешь, сервер руганется типа There are X dependences on FIELD MYFIELD In .........
     
     
  • 9.41, Аноним (-), 00:17, 09/10/2011 [^] [ответить]    [к модератору]  
  • +/
    И тут ты понимаешь что всё - надо подниматься из бэкапа ... а как известно фраербирд и бэкап - это та ещё рулетка! :)
    А так да - ынтрпраёз реди ....
     
     
  • 10.46, Гектор Зажигайло (?), 13:33, 09/10/2011 [^] [ответить]     [к модератору]  
  • +1 +/
    Хватит пургу гнать Даже когда этот баг ещё был, у меня не было ни одного невост... весь текст скрыт [показать]
     
     
  • 11.48, Аноним (-), 01:03, 10/10/2011 [^] [ответить]     [к модератору]  
  • +/
    Ну да Или цикл - бэкап рестор на другую железку До тех пор пока не сработает... весь текст скрыт [показать]
     
     
  • 12.53, Kodirr (?), 13:01, 10/10/2011 [^] [ответить]    [к модератору]  
  • +/
    > только мы перешли на нормальную базу

    Нет такой "Нормальная база 1.0". Все решения - в той или иной мере г-но. Чем смеяться над другими, лучше расширить свой кругозор.

     
  • 12.55, Гектор Зажигайло (?), 15:20, 10/10/2011 [^] [ответить]     [к модератору]  
  • +/
    Это про какую базу вы постеснялись нам рассказать Мне самому интересно было бы... весь текст скрыт [показать]
     
     
  • 13.56, Гектор Зажигайло (?), 15:27, 10/10/2011 [^] [ответить]     [к модератору]  
  • +/
    ps с Firebird работаю с тех времён ещё, когда он был 5м Interbase - у меня не бы... весь текст скрыт [показать]
     
  • 13.60, Avator (ok), 19:18, 12/10/2011 [^] [ответить]     [к модератору]  
  • +/
    Судя по тому, что комментатор постеснялся назвадь СУБД, под нормальной СУБД он... весь текст скрыт [показать]
     
  • 2.25, letsmac (ok), 20:37, 07/10/2011 [^] [ответить]    [к модератору]  
  • +/
    Каким местом она уровня слона? FB своя база со своими достоинствами - по надежности она в первой тройке. Не перегружена лишней функциональностью. На производстве незаменима.
     
  • 1.12, name (??), 15:06, 07/10/2011 [ответить] [показать ветку] [···]    [к модератору]  
  • +/
    столько изменений, а номер версии изменился всего в третьем числе, в отличие от некоторых сами знаете кого.
     
  • 1.14, Аноним (-), 15:18, 07/10/2011 [ответить] [показать ветку] [···]    [к модератору]  
  • +/
    Да.. когда-то были эпические споры firebird vs postgresql.
    Но время рассудило и сейчас уже все ясно.

     
     
  • 2.20, pro100master (ok), 17:46, 07/10/2011 [^] [ответить]    [к модератору]  
  • –1 +/
    > Да.. когда-то были эпические споры firebird vs postgresql.
    > Но время рассудило и сейчас уже все ясно.

    Кому ясно? А в плане встраиваемых? :)

     
     
  • 3.35, Anonymouse (?), 01:45, 08/10/2011 [^] [ответить]    [к модератору]  
  • –2 +/
    >А в плане встраиваемых? :)

    SQLite дуд. Именно так.

     
     
  • 4.39, pro100master (ok), 16:33, 08/10/2011 [^] [ответить]    [к модератору]  
  • +/
    лол. Вы хоть представляете себе разницу? Сравнили хрен с пальцем.
     
     
  • 5.49, Аноним (-), 01:10, 10/10/2011 [^] [ответить]     [к модератору]  
  • +/
    Конечно сынок С Разница например в том что SQLite рвёт как Тузик грелку это ... весь текст скрыт [показать]
     
     
  • 6.57, Гектор Зажигайло (?), 15:42, 10/10/2011 [^] [ответить]    [к модератору]  
  • +/
    > Конечно сынок!(С)

    Чувак, SQLLite это ВСТРАИВАЕМОЕ, это не клиент-сервет. Выражение "Хрен с пальцем" (С) был достаточно точно.

     
     
  • 7.59, Аноним (-), 05:07, 12/10/2011 [^] [ответить]    [к модератору]  
  • +/
    До чего же вы тупой! (С) :-)

    Вверх то попику откатитсь и посмотри на что отвечаешь :)

    >>А в плане встраиваемых? :)
    >SQLite дуд. Именно так.

     
  • 1.15, Sokoloff (?), 15:37, 07/10/2011 [ответить] [показать ветку] [···]    [к модератору]  
  • +/
    А еще он имеет embedded режим. Причем база та же самая, с рабочими хранимками, вюшками, и прочим. Все отличие, это путь к базе.

    Т.е. амароки и акондаи могли не тянуть mysql, а иметь по умолчанию embeded FB, а те особенные, которым этого не хватает, могли поставить FB сервер и поменять путь в настройках.

    P.S. Embeded база может быть readonly, т.е. можно на CD положить базу и программу для работы с ней.

     
     
  • 2.18, Аноним (-), 17:33, 07/10/2011 [^] [ответить]    [к модератору]  
  • +1 +/
    Для этого есть SQLite - на среднем компе молотит 50000 транзакций в секунду (так утверждает документация). Хотя SQLite, по-моему, не умеет процедурный SQL, если он конечно нужен в таких случаях
     
  • 1.16, Аноним (-), 17:10, 07/10/2011 [ответить] [показать ветку] [···]    [к модератору]  
  • +/
    Тоже активно используем у себя. Конечно до PostgreSQL даже близко не дотягивает, но как встраиваемая база (Embeded) очень хорошее решение.
     
     
  • 2.17, MadAdmin (?), 17:18, 07/10/2011 [^] [ответить]    [к модератору]  
  • +/
    А в чем не дотягивает?
     
     
  • 3.26, letsmac (ok), 20:39, 07/10/2011 [^] [ответить]    [к модератору]  
  • +/
    Да во всём - минимум функционала максимум надежности. И это главное её достоинство.

     
     
  • 4.28, Феликс Жопорезку (?), 21:27, 07/10/2011 [^] [ответить]    [к модератору]  
  • +/
    > Да во всём - минимум функционала максимум надежности. И это главное её
    > достоинство.

    Хочу пример жизненно необходимого того, чего нет в Firebird и есть в Postgree

     
     
  • 5.30, Аноним (-), 22:01, 07/10/2011 [^] [ответить]     [к модератору]  
  • +/
    Есть пример того, чего нет в обеих FLASHBACK QUREY и FLASHBACK RECOVERY ... весь текст скрыт [показать]
     
     
  • 6.32, Гектор Зажигайло (?), 22:42, 07/10/2011 [^] [ответить]    [к модератору]  
  • +/
    > Есть пример того, чего нет в обеих. FLASHBACK QUREY и FLASHBACK RECOVERY.

    Жизненно необходимые функции, это такие функции, при использовании которых не вспоминается старый бородатый анекдот: "А теперь мы со всем этим г..м попытаемся взлететь"


     
     
  • 7.36, Square (ok), 11:14, 08/10/2011 [^] [ответить]    [к модератору]  
  • +/
    Некоторые летают...
     
  • 5.43, Аноним (-), 00:25, 09/10/2011 [^] [ответить]    [к модератору]  
  • +/
    > Хочу пример жизненно необходимого того, чего нет в Firebird и есть в  Postgree

    Fulltext search
    Gist и вообще вся Гео*
    ...
    Работающий бэкап в конце концов :-)))

     
     
  • 6.45, Kisa (??), 12:22, 09/10/2011 [^] [ответить]    [к модератору]  
  • +/
    Уважаемый, замените уже, наконец, битую оперативку на исправную, и будет Вам работающий бекап:-)
     
     
  • 7.50, Аноним (-), 01:13, 10/10/2011 [^] [ответить]     [к модератору]  
  • +/
    Уважаемый - а почему говённый MS-SQL и MySQL _на той же_ машине проблем не имели... весь текст скрыт [показать]
     
  • 6.47, Гектор Зажигайло (?), 13:38, 09/10/2011 [^] [ответить]    [к модератору]  
  • +/
    >> Хочу пример жизненно необходимого того, чего нет в Firebird и есть в  Postgree
    > Fulltext search

    Sphinx Full Text Search


    > Gist и вообще вся Гео*

    Жизненно необходимое, а не понты, которые просто иначе реализцются

    > ...
    > Работающий бэкап в конце концов :-)))

    Бекапы отлично работаю

     
     
  • 7.51, Аноним (-), 01:18, 10/10/2011 [^] [ответить]     [к модератору]  
  • +/
    Ути пуси А ты пробовал А попробуй Оно не труднее чем играть на рояле пр... весь текст скрыт [показать]
     
     
  • 8.54, Kodirr (?), 13:07, 10/10/2011 [^] [ответить]    [к модератору]  
  • +/
    >>> Gist и вообще вся Гео*

    Извините, но "вся Гео" является "жизненно необходимым" 1%-ту приложений. Я даже намеренно не использую те же "tree structures" из свежего MS SQL 2008 - просто чтобы потом не кусать локти, переходя на ораслы/фиребирды.

     
     
  • 9.58, Fedor (??), 15:53, 10/10/2011 [^] [ответить]    [к модератору]  
  • +/
    В некоторых отраслях ГИС приложения занимают 90% всего используемого ПО. PostgreSQL/Postgis  предоставляют широкий набор функций для пространственных операций. А У FB как с этим ?
     

     Добавить комментарий
    Имя:
    E-Mail:
    Заголовок:
    Текст:


    Закладки на сайте
    Проследить за страницей
    Created 1996-2019 by Maxim Chirkov
    Добавить, Поддержать, Вебмастеру
    Hosting by Ihor